We are reaching out to raise funds to support the delivery of a community event, which is being held to to celebrate the 75th anniversary of VE Day
This 75th Anniversary of VE Day is likely be the last significant celebration to be held due to our ageing veterans from WW2 so it’s important that we capture those events in history.
LEE VE75 is an event to celebrate the 75th Anniversary of VE Day for the community by the community. But with the COVID19 Crisis, the main event programme has been postponed but we'll be online with Facebook Live on May 8th with music and entertainment.
WHEN LEEVE75 ACTUALLY HAPPENS
The vision of LEE VE75 is to bring those veterans, men & women who experienced VE Day first hand together with re-enactment groups and give them the platform to share their experiences with the younger generations of Lee on the Solent, so their memories and the relationship of Lee and its role in the war can be captured, shared and celebrated through an array of elements to create a remarkable and memorable event.
The main event will be held on a Saturday - new date to be confirmed and will be started by a parade to create an amazing atmosphere.
LEE VE75 will be using various areas to create interest for all. We intend to create a living history area with a display of WW2 military and civilian vehicles, along dressed personnel, to help build a legacy of VE Day for future generations. This will be supported by a themed 40's era High Street with displays, entertainment and attractions. The day will finish with a musical picnic on the recreation ground where acts will provide musical entertainment. There will also be a church service at St Faiths on Sunday 10th.
The funding thats raised through here will go towards the infrastructure that’s needed for a successful quality event. Tbis includes items such as staging, PA systems & sound engineers, tents, toilets, fencing, power requirements and security. There’s the decoration of the event including flags & bunting and how these are fixed. There’s the branding, marketing and promotions. Then there’s the costs of acts for the entertainment and attractions throughout the event. With the link between veterans & the pupils of Lee we are wanting to give away a commemorative mug to the pupils and provide food the veterans whilst they are with us during the day.
